Sirius vulcans 200 spine
29.5 long
Magnus 125 single bevel with 100 outsert
Weight ~580 gr.
70# prime inline

I like how they fly (no problems out to 50 which is as much room as I have to shoot)and I can sharpen them to scary sharp in less than half the time it used to take on the Magnus stingers I used to shoot.
The first broadhead I ever purchased was a g5 striker and killed a 4 x 5 muley that same year, the blood trail was amazing and the deer only made it 20 yards.  The only thing I didn't like was the replaceable blade had broken inside the animal.  I switched because I wanted a single bevel fixed for elk and deer.
That was the long answer, short answer is yes I would.
